Workers' Compensation

Workers who have been injured due to asbestos exposure can claim workers compensation benefits. The benefits of a workers' comp claim can include medical costs as well as partial wages and other costs related to work-related injuries. However, workers' compensation claims aren't the best choice for those who are exposed to asbestos because they have a limited time period within which to claim and also offer lower maximum benefits than personal injury or mesothelioma lawsuits.

An experienced attorney can help determine whether an asbestos-related illness is a work-related accident and if an individual is eligible for benefits under workers' comp. An attorney can also explain the specific laws of each state that govern workers' compensation and help in completing the deadlines that vary from state to state. An attorney can also provide advice on alternative legal options for seeking compensation, such as filing mesothelioma lawsuits or asbestos trust fund claim.

Personal Injury

Asbestos lawyers help victims who have been exposed to asbestos and are suffering from a condition or illness like mesothelioma. The condition can develop 15 to 60 years after exposure and can be fatal. Victims may be eligible for financial compensation through asbestos victim trust funds in addition to filing a lawsuit against the responsible company.

Asbestos is a class of naturally occurring minerals made of a thin, tough fiber. Because of its resistance to heat, fire and chemicals the mineral was sought-after by industrial companies for a variety of products during the 20th Century. Unfortunately, the manufacturing companies did not disclose or even conceal asbestos' dangers, and caused the deaths of thousands of Americans.

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ness such as mesothelioma, or lung cancer, may make a personal injury claim against the companies who manufactured and distributed or installed asbestos-containing materials. The lawsuits seek compensation from the companies for medical expenses as well as lost wages, suffering and pain.

New York law generally gives plaintiffs 3 years from the date they were diagnosed to pursue a lawsuit for personal injury. The statute of limitations may be extended in asbestos cases, since symptoms usually do not manifest for a period of 30 to 50 years after the initial exposure.

Wrongful Death

If a person dies a result of asbestos exposure and their family members can file a wrongful death claim. This type of lawsuit is filed on behalf of the deceased's estate, and it is possible to file it regardless of whether or not the decedent had a will. A lawyer who handles wrongful deaths can assist family members in seeking compensation from those who are responsible for their loved one's death.

These claims are brought against employers and property owners who failed to ensure that their employees are safe from asbestos. In these cases, the main problem is that asbestos particles inhaled cause fibrosis in the lining of the lung. Over time the fibrosis turns malignant and may turn into tumors, such as mesothelioma. Asbestos wrongful death attorneys must prove that the defendant's negligence caused the asbestos-related disease. They must also prove that mesothelioma was a direct consequence of the asbestos exposure. This requires accessing medical records, contacting witnesses and obtaining documentation at the workplace where the deceased worked.
